Web17 apr. 2024 · At 948m (3,110ft), Tugela Falls in KwaZulu-Natal Province is the highest waterfall in Africa, and the second highest in the world after Venezuela’s Angel Falls at 1,283m (4,210ft). WebThe falls are the second highest in the world with 948 m. Due to snowfall, we started at midday and sunset was roughly at 6 p.m. in September. It was quite tough with only six hours left for hiking. We decided to walk to the foot of the falls, in total more or less 15 km. Coming in second on the list of the largest waterfalls in the world, Tugela Falls is a brilliant sight. Located among the Drakensberg mountains in South Africa’s Royal Natal National Park, the waterfall measures a total of 948 meters high. It is the world's tallest uninterrupted waterfall, with a height of 979 metres (3,212 ft) and a plunge of 807 m (2,648 ft).
